Former Bangladeshi Test cricketer and MP of the now-defunct Awami League, Naimur Rahman Durjoy, has been arrested by the authorities on two isolated charges of corruption. The former Test cricketer was rounded up by a team from Manikganj Detective Branch (DB) at Lalmatia in Dhaka. While addressing the media on July 3, Manikganj Superintendent of Police (SP) Yasmin Khatun revealed that Durjoy had two active cases filed against him in two different police stations. 

Durjoy's arrest comes in the wake of the ouster of Sheikh Hasina, the country's long-standing Prime Minister, who was forcefully removed from power on the back of a powerful student uprising last year. Following the takeover by Mohammed Yunis' interim government, earlier members of Hasina's now-outlawed Awami League political party face charges of arrest. A look into Durjoy's journey from cricket to politics

Naimur Rahman Durjoy was the first captain of the Bangladesh Test side and took over the captaincy reins in early 2000 when Bangladesh achieved their Test status from the ICC. He captained his national side during their first-ever Test on home soil against India at the Bangabandhu National Stadium. 

As years rolled by, he quietly withdrew from the cricket scene and entered politics by joining the Awami League. Then in 2014, he entered parliament and secured a second term, but was denied nomination in 2024. After the fall of Hasina's government, it all went downhill for Durjoy. The Anti-Corruption Commission (ACC) lodged corruption charges against Durjoy. Then, on September 24, 2024, the ACC demanded bank records of Durjoy and his wife, Farhana Rahman.

And to make matters worse, a Dhaka court imposed a travel ban on Durjoy and his family on October 3, 2024, barring him from any international travel.
